#009 l Shun Hing Square l SHENZHEN l 384m l 69fl
 
Shun Hing Square
Shenzhen, China


HEIGHT: 384m/1,260 feet
FLOORS: 69 floors
COMPLETION: 1996
ARCHITECT: K.Y. Cheung Design Associates

Shun Hing Square is the tallest steel building in China and the tallest building overall in Shenzhen. The tower is a thin slab with rounded corners clad in glass. Aluminum and glass covers the larger faces. Two turrets on the roof of the building conceal window-washing equipment and support the twin masts.

Shun Hing Square also provides offices, apartments, and a shopping arcade complex. The shopping arcade is a five-storey mall with four sets of escalators, five passenger lifts and two service lifts and a floor area ranging from 3450m2 to 4900m2. There is an observation floor called "Meridian View Centre" at the 69th floor.
